I was responding to Silent Joe's topic about finding year of manufacture of Italian guns by looking up the code stamped on the barrel or frame. When I went to my bookmarked page of these codes on Bluebook's website, the page no longer existed. I found out Bluebook had moved their website, and when I started from their new homepage and looked up the page with the Italian codes, it now contains serial numbers vs. year of manufacture for various Pietta guns from mid-1980's up through 1999. The Pietta data has been in the Blue Book of Modern BP Arms since the begining - or at least since the 3rd edition. The Proofmark.pdf page still exists. Here is the link: https://bluebookofgunvalues.com/Info/PDF/POWDER/MBPProofmarks.pdf The Pietta page you link to is out of date. The 7th edition page number is 291.
